Horse racing‚ often dubbed the “Sport of Kings‚” holds a romantic allure. But beyond the spectacle‚ lies a question many ask: can you actually make money betting on it? The short answer is yes‚ but it’s far from easy. It requires knowledge‚ discipline‚ and a healthy dose of luck. This article explores the realities of profiting from horse racing bets.

Understanding the Challenges

Before diving into strategies‚ acknowledge the hurdles. The track takes a cut (the ‘vig’ or ‘juice’) on every bet‚ meaning the payout is always less than true odds. Furthermore‚ horse racing is inherently unpredictable. Factors like horse form‚ jockey skill‚ track conditions (going)‚ and even weather play crucial roles. A seemingly sure thing can easily be upset.

Key Factors Influencing Outcomes

  • Horse Form: Recent race results‚ speed figures‚ and workout times.
  • Jockey & Trainer: Successful pairings and their track records.
  • Track Conditions: ‘Fast’‚ ‘muddy’‚ ‘sloppy’‚ ‘firm’‚ ‘good’ – each impacts performance.
  • Post Position: Starting gate position can be advantageous or disadvantageous.
  • Weight Carried: Higher weight can slow a horse down.

Betting Strategies for Potential Profit

Several betting types offer different risk/reward profiles. Understanding these is vital.

Common Bet Types

  1. Win: Horse must finish first.
  2. Place: Horse must finish first or second.
  3. Show: Horse must finish first‚ second‚ or third.
  4. Exacta: Pick the first and second horses in the correct order.
  5. Trifecta: Pick the first‚ second‚ and third horses in the correct order.
  6. Superfecta: Pick the first‚ second‚ third‚ and fourth horses in the correct order.

More complex bets (Exacta‚ Trifecta‚ Superfecta) offer larger payouts but are significantly harder to win. Focusing on simpler bets initially is recommended.

Strategies to Consider

  • Handicapping: Thoroughly analyze past performances‚ form cycles‚ and relevant data.
  • Value Betting: Identify bets where the odds offered are higher than your assessed probability of winning.
  • Dutching: Betting on multiple horses in the same race to guarantee a profit regardless of which horse wins (requires careful calculation).
  • Arbitrage Betting: Exploiting differences in odds offered by different bookmakers (rare and requires quick action).

Bankroll Management is Crucial

Even the best handicappers experience losing streaks. Effective bankroll management is paramount.

Tips for Responsible Betting

  • Set a Budget: Only bet what you can afford to lose.
  • Unit Size: Bet a consistent percentage of your bankroll per race (e.g.‚ 1-2%).
  • Avoid Chasing Losses: Don’t increase your bets to recoup losses quickly.
  • Keep Records: Track your bets‚ wins‚ and losses to analyze your performance.
